GIRARD v. SINGLETARY

No. 82355.

641 So.2d 72 (1994)

Eric GIRARD, Petitioner, v. Harry K. SINGLETARY, etc., Respondents.

Supreme Court of Florida.

August 25, 1994.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Eric Girard, pro se, petitioner.

Susan A. Maher, Deputy Gen. Counsel, Dept. of Corrections, Tallahassee, for respondent.


PER CURIAM.

Eric Girard petitions this Court for habeas corpus, which we treat as a petition for writ of mandamus. We have jurisdiction. Art. V, § 3(b)(8), Fla. Const. The petition is denied on the authority of Griffin v. Singletary, 638 So.2d 500 (Fla. 1994).

It is so ordered.
